Understanding Mainframe NSCorp and Its Core Architecture
Mainframe NSCorp refers to the enterprise-level computing systems used by Norfolk Southern Corporation to manage large-scale operations. These systems are designed to process massive volumes of data quickly and reliably, making them ideal for industries like transportation, banking, and government services. Mainframes differ from traditional servers in their ability to handle thousands of concurrent transactions with minimal downtime.
The architecture of mainframe NSCorp typically revolves around centralized computing. This means that instead of distributing workloads across multiple smaller systems, a single powerful mainframe handles the bulk of processing. Technologies like virtualization and partitioning allow multiple applications to run simultaneously without interference. This structure ensures high availability, fault tolerance, and unmatched performance—essential features for a railway network that operates around the clock.

The Role of Mainframe NSCorp in Railway Operations
Railway operations involve a complex web of scheduling, tracking, maintenance, and customer service. Mainframe NSCorp serves as the central nervous system that ties all these elements together. It processes real-time data from trains, tracks, and logistics hubs, enabling precise coordination across the network.
One of the most critical functions of mainframe NSCorp is train scheduling and dispatching. By analyzing variables such as track availability, weather conditions, and cargo priorities, the system ensures optimal routing. This not only improves efficiency but also reduces delays and operational costs. The ability to process real-time data makes it possible to adjust schedules dynamically, ensuring smooth operations even under unexpected circumstances.
Additionally, mainframe NSCorp plays a vital role in freight management. It tracks shipments from origin to destination, providing accurate updates to customers and stakeholders. This level of transparency enhances customer trust and satisfaction. Moreover, the system supports predictive maintenance by analyzing equipment data, helping prevent breakdowns and ensuring safety.

Challenges and Future of Mainframe NSCorp
While mainframe NSCorp offers numerous benefits, it also comes with its own set of challenges. One of the primary issues is the shortage of skilled professionals. Mainframe technology requires specialized knowledge, and finding experts with the necessary skills can be difficult. This skills gap can hinder the effective management and modernization of mainframe systems.
Another challenge is the perception of mainframes as outdated technology. Despite their capabilities, many organizations view them as legacy systems that need to be replaced. However, this perception is changing as businesses recognize the value of mainframes in handling critical workloads. The focus is now shifting towards modernization rather than replacement.
